          Same reason there’s a ScrollLock key on keyboards. Didn’t always have scrollbars and if the application prints more than you can read, you want to pause that…

          Short answer, terminals are built on the same technology as physical terminals from the 60s and 70s when controlling the flow of data from the server was a more useful feature.

        GNU readline is the library that powers features like Ctrl-A, Ctrl-R and Alt+S. By default, it is in emacs mode - that is why it supports these shortcuts, they are the same as in emacs. It also supports vi style editing. You can switch to that by typing set -o vi in your shell. Then you can edit commands as if you were in vi, for example, instead of Ctrl-A you’d do Esc 0. Instead of Ctrl-R you’d do Esc /. If you are fluent in vi then this mode will be more useful.

        I used to work on really old Unix systems, sometimes over serial connections. They didn’t have bash (only ksh), and they didn’t understand arrow keys. Vi mode was the only way to edit commands that worked reliably.
